Poppy anemone 'St. Brigid'

Anemone coronaria

How to grow Poppy anemone 'St. Brigid'

  • Partial Sun

  • Medium

Plant in a location that enjoys partial sun and remember to water moderately. Keep in mind when planting that St. Brigid is thought of as half hardy, so protect with a row cover whenever the temperatures drop.

Growing St. Brigid from seed

Try to ensure a gap of at least 3.12 inches (8.0 cm) when sowing to prevent overcrowding your seedlings. Soil temperature should be kept higher than 10°C / 50°F to ensure good germination.

Transplanting St. Brigid

Ensure that temperatures are mild and all chance of frost has passed before planting out, as St. Brigid is a half hardy plant.
